I would like to know, what is the rule concerning,
- Informing others of a false hadith?
walaikum assalam.

It was narrated that ‘Ali (may Allah be pleased with him): “The Prophet (peace and blessings of Allah be upon him) said: ‘Do not tell lies about me. Whoever tells lies about me, let him enter the Fire.’”

(Narrated by al-Bukhari, 106).
- Preaching of weak ahadith?

some fuqaha accepted weak hadiths only at the matter of fadail, but it should not be very weak.
- Listening to false ahadith and then applying it as sunnah?

that is the thing, whcih we call bidah. "…Every innovation is a going astray and every going astray is in the fire." (Tirmidhi)
- Making a false hadith, a motivation to spur someone in his or her ibadah, although he or she does not apply the hadith. Just as a motivation?

It was narrated that ‘Ali (may Allah be pleased with him): “The Prophet (peace and blessings of Allah be upon him) said: ‘Do not tell lies about me. Whoever tells lies about me, let him enter the Fire.’”
